1929–30 Belfast Charity Cup

The 1929–30 Belfast Charity Cup was the 47th edition of the Belfast Charity Cup, a cup competition in Northern Irish football.[1]

Linfield won the title for the 19th time, defeating Belfast Celtic 2–0 in the final.[2][3]
